Ticket QV-registry: Quota-config vault locked, tenants throttled

Severity: High. The Mistvale quota service cannot read per-tenant rate limits because its config vault sealed itself after three failed agent renewals. Affected tenants are falling back to the global default, throttling the larger accounts. On-call should unseal the vault manually from the admin shell, then restart the quota reconciler and confirm limits repopulate. Unseal with the recovery passphrase below.

unlock words, yahip-hahop: casath-oliox

Ticket SEC-208 — Locked vault blocking CSV Import Wizard release. Context for review: the Granule import wizard at Tellwick Systems signs column-mapping templates with a key held in the ops vault. Vault sealed itself after the node restart on Monday; no unseal quorum reached. No evidence of tampering — audit log is clean. Requesting sign-off to use the documented recovery path. Per policy, the recovery passphrase for the sealed vault follows below.

unlock words, yageg-faweg: briael-quenox-rusox

## Authentication

Hey, welcome aboard! Quick note: the Cartwheel orders table uses soft deletes, so never hard-delete rows — just flip the archived flag and let the sweeper handle cleanup. To query archived orders you'll hit the internal Ledgerette service, which needs a key on every request. Here's the one for your sandbox environment.

app token of bahaf-tajeg = zpat23_SjjsllwiLmXbtS65veZaV47